Warehousing

Warehouses use industrial forklifts for efficient movement of goods, especially due to the high demand in the e-commerce sector. These sectors mainly use forklifts for loading and unloading goods, moving pallets, and lifting and stacking goods on high shelves. The common forklifts they use are electric, reach trucks, and order pickers. Many warehouses use electric forklifts due to their lower emissions and quiet operations. Additionally, they use reach trucks and order pickers to maneuver narrow aisles and high storage.

Manufacturing units

One of the common industrial forklift applications you will find is in manufacturing units.  They use forklifts for handling raw materials, transporting goods throughout different stages of production, managing finished goods, etc. As the needs in manufacturing units vary, they might use counterbalance forklifts, side loaders, and telescopic handlers. Counterbalance forklifts help transport heavy materials. On the other hand, side loaders and telescopic handlers help transport long and bulky materials.

Construction Sites

Another common industrial forklift applications are for construction sites. They use forklifts in transporting goods across worksites. Construction projects usually need durable forklifts that can survive in a rugged outdoor environment. Hence, they often use rough-terrain forklifts, telehandlers, etc. Rough-terrain forklifts can operate on uneven ground and challenging terrains. Hence, they are well-suited for construction sites. On the other hand, telehandlers can reach high places, which allows them to lift pallets of tiles, bricks, and other materials used in construction sites.

Retail

Retails are one of the common industrial forklift applications. Due to their high turnover rates, they use forklifts to rearrange products constantly. The forklifts they commonly use are narrow-aisle, pallet jacks, etc. Pallet jacks help unload goods and organize inventories. On the other hand, narrow-aisle forklifts are ideal for operating in tight spaces, and hence, are ideal for high-density storage.

The following are the 7 most common forklifts used in different industries.

  • Counterbalance Forklifts – These are the most popular and versatile forklifts, used mainly in warehouses. They feature forks at the front and a heavy counterweight in the back. It allowed lifting loads without the need for stabilizing outriggers.
  • Reach Truck – They are specifically designed for narrow aisles and high-rack storage, with forks that extend forward for better reach.
  • Telehandler (Telescopic Handler) – They feature an extendable boom that functions like a crane. These forklifts are ideal for construction sites to lift materials to high and awkward locations.
  • Rough Terrain Forklift – They feature large, rugged pneumatic tires for navigating uneven surfaces. These forklifts are commonly used in construction and lumber yards.
  • Pallet Jacks – They help transport palletized loads over short distances and are often used in retail or tight warehouse spaces.
  • Order Picker – They help lift the operator to the shelving level, allowing them to pick individual items rather than whole pallets. These forklifts are usually used in narrow aisle warehouse settings.
  • Sideloader – They are ideal for long, heavy loads like pipes or timber. These forklifts load from the side, allowing them to travel down narrow aisles with wide items.

The following are the 7 classes of forklifts –

  • Class I: Electric Motor Rider Trucks: These are electric-powered, sit-down or stand-up counterbalance trucks used for indoor and clean-surface operations.
  • Class II: Electric Motor Narrow Aisle Trucks: These are designed for tight spaces and include reach trucks, side-loaders, and order pickers.
  • Class III: Electric Motor Hand/Rider Trucks: These are walkie-stackers or electric pallet jacks, often hand-controlled, designed for short-distance, low-level transport.
  • Class IV: Internal Combustion Engine Trucks (Cushion Tires): These include propane, gasoline, or diesel-powered trucks with solid tires designed for smooth and indoor concrete floors.
  • Class V: Internal Combustion Engine Trucks (Pneumatic Tires): These forklifts are equipped with heavy-duty, air-filled, or solid pneumatic tires for rougher surfaces or outdoor use.
  • Class VI: Electric and Internal Combustion Engine Tractors: These are primarily used for towing. They help pull, rather than lift, loads, often used in factories or airports.
  • Class VII: Rough Terrain Forklift Trucks: They are equipped with large and rugged tires designed for construction sites, lumber yards, and uneven ground, including telehandlers.

When operating a forklift in your facility, you should abide by the following 5 safety rules.

  • Operator Training and Certification – Only certified and trained personnel should operate forklifts. You should get their performance evaluated every 2–3 years.
  • Daily Inspection – You should perform checks before each shift, including brakes, steering, mast, and tires, and never operate damaged equipment.
  • Load Handling Safety – Forklifts should never exceed the rated capacity. They should keep loads stable and travel with the load low (approx. 4 inches off the ground).
  • Speed and Stability – Operators should drive the forklifts at a safe speed, slow down for turns, and avoid sharp turns to prevent tip-overs.
  • Pedestrian Awareness – Operators should use horns at intersections and always yield to pedestrians.

The following are OSHA’s 3 most cited violations.

  • Inadequate Training/Certification – Issues include untrained operators, missing refresher training, or failure to conduct mandatory three-year evaluations.
  • Lack of Pre-Operation Inspections – Issues include operators frequently failing to conduct or document required daily visual/operational checks of tires, forks, brakes, and lights.
  • Unsafe Operation & Handling – Common issues include speeding, driving with obstructed views, improper stacking, carrying loads that are too heavy, or failing to use seatbelts.
